My first shot at making a clock dial for 24-hour clock movements (where the hour hand moves around the dial once daily instead of twice). I wanted a clock with noon at the top and midnight at the bottom. The numbers and ticks are from a vector I made years ago in Inkscape. The next iteration will use thicker numbers and fewer ticks. They were a little too small for the printer to do a great job in some areas. Still, it looks great on a wall. This is just a disc; be sure to get a movement with hanging hardware. I've added hands that look much better (and are stiffer) than those in my original photo. These hands were made for an OK888 24-hour movement. These use press-fit hands with 3.1mm diameter for the minute shaft and 5.0mm for the hour shaft, similar to other “12888” style movements.
